Explanation:

Identify polymer type and monomer

Using the Addition Polymerization knowledge point

  • Poly(ethene) is formed by linking unsaturated ethene monomers without losing any small molecules.
  • This process is known as addition polymerization, making it an addition polymer.
  • The starting small molecules are ethene monomers.

Determine polymer uses and environmental properties

  • Poly(ethene) is commonly used to manufacture plastic bags, packaging films, or squeeze bottles.
  • Because it consists of strong, non-polar carbon-carbon single bonds, decomposers cannot break it down.
  • Therefore, it is non-biodegradable, causing it to persist in landfills.
